Kutpai - Goilkera, West Singhbhum

Kutpai is a village situated in the Goilkera subdivision of West Singhbhum district, Jharkhand. It is located approximately 39 km from Chakardharpur and around 61 km from Chaibasa. Bara serves as the Gram Panchayat for Kutpai village.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Kutpai is 377579. The village covers a total geographical area of 173 hectares and falls under the 833103 pincode.

Kutpai village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Manoharpur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Singhbhum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.

Population of Kutpai

As per Census 2011, Kutpai village has a total population of 604 people, consisting of 306 males and 298 females. The village has 119 households and a sex ratio of 973 females per 1,000 males. There are 122 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 189 literate and 415 illiterate residents. Additionally, 604 people belong to Scheduled Tribe (ST) communities.

Transport and Connectivity of Kutpai

Kutpai is connected by an all-weather road, while public transport facilities are available within 2-5 km of the village. The nearest railway station is Goilkera, while the nearest airport is Birsa Munda Airport, situated at an approximate aerial distance of 70.7 km.
